Responsibilities

  • Plan and manage a production schedule for designated manufacturing areas.
  • Utilize SAP and SAP/APO to develop near term and long-term production plans
  • Utilize SAP/APO to maintain forecast performance
  • Utilize SAP and SAP/APO to maintain proper stock levels in both local and international distribution sites
  • Work with manufacturing to maintain parity between costing and BOM/Routing changes
  • Develop initiatives to improve inventory, scrap and margin performance
  • Work with Product Management to align build schedule with forecast and schedule new product introductions
  • Interact with the sales team to expedite and capitalize on fast moving opportunities
  • Communicate with both domestic and international Customer Service groups to provide timely stocking updates and resolve order specific issues
  • In addition to a firm understanding of fundamental planning concepts the position requires strong analytical and computer skills, including the ability to analyze data and structure reports
